Ray ‘Abe’ Mallow

Ray "Abe" Mallow, 74, a resident of Harman, passed from this life Wednesday, Feb. 28, 2024, at White Sulphur Springs Center in Greenbrier County.

Ray was born Thursday, June 9, 1949, in Onego, a son of the late Omar Lee Mallow and Ocie Morral Mallow. He married the former Shirley Esther Dean, who survives at home. They had just celebrated 50 years of marriage.

Also left to cherish his memory are two children, Mandy Phillips and husband, Robert, of Valley Bend, and Jason Mallow and companion, Priscilla Taylor, of Dryfork; four grandchildren, Allyson Kyle and boyfriend, Dominic Barker, Connor Kyle, Walker Mallow and Dylan Phillips; siblings, Larry, Robert, and Dolan Mallow, Sharon Bonner, Donna Zahn and husband, Jack; several nieces and nephews; sisters-in-law, Amy Armentrout and Betsy Dean; five special friends, Elvin Kisamore, Jim Nelson, John Summerfield, Davie Bonner and Gary Nelson; and three fur babies, Mia, Bandit and Tiny.

Preceding him in death besides his parents were three siblings, Ruby Kisamore, Grace Corbitt and Ricky Mallow.

Ray attended the schools of Randolph County and then served his country in the United States Army. He was employed as a heavy equipment operator for Groundbreakers. Abe enjoyed tinkering in his garage, mowing the yard, and making hay.

Most of all, he adored his grandchildren and loved spending time with them.

Visitation will be held at the Randolph Funeral Home Thursday, March 7, 2024, from 5 p.m. until 7 p.m. Ray's request for cremation will then be honored.

The Randolph Funeral Home and Cremation Services has been entrusted with the arrangements for Ray Mallow.
